Report exports in Tallyglass always render timestamps in the tenant's configured zone, never server local time. If a tenant has no zone set, fall back to UTC and flag the export header. Do not trust the scheduler host clock; it drifts. DST transitions: exports spanning the changeover must use zone-aware arithmetic, not fixed offsets. If a customer reports shifted rows, check the tenant zone record first, then the exporter version. Confirm against the build token below.

pipeline stamp: htk4_ae36

## Tuning

Vexlin compresses telemetry payloads before shipping them to the Drift ingest tier. Compression level trades CPU for bandwidth; batch size trades latency for ratio. Defaults were chosen on the Karwood staging cluster and hold up fine under normal load. Don't lower the batch floor without checking ingest backpressure first. The current constants are listed below.

constants for bawep-yawep:
WEIGHTS = {
    "fenir": 600,
    "tammir": 848,
    "fraion": 470,
    "briael": 914,
    "belix": 412,
}

# Artifact Signing: Cron Drift Notes

During the Brindlewick cron drift investigation we confirmed that nightly signing jobs fired up to 40 minutes late, but no artifacts were signed with stale metadata. The scheduler clock has since been pinned to the internal NTP pool. All builds from the Marrow pipeline must still be verified against the key below.

signing key of yajog-kafof = bky19_orbYRY3Abj3KpZesMie

Briefing for Leadership Review — Tillrose Licensing Dispute

For the board: our dispute with Quarnell Media over the Tillrose content licence has moved to formal mediation. Quarnell asserts the renewal clause lapsed; our counsel considers this position weak but not negligible. Estimated exposure remains within the provisioned range, and mediation concludes within eight weeks. Operational impact is presently contained to the Averton catalogue. The confidential statement of our strategic intentions appears directly below.

confidential, kagep-kahof: Druokax Systems plans to lower the Ulaath list price by 53 percent in March.